The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) and the American College of Occupational and Environmental Medicine (ACOEM) Medical Fellow Research Program was established in 2005. The Fellowship program supports the work of a medical scholar in the area of commercial motor vehicle driver health and safety.
Areas of particular interest include: - Use of drug/alcohol by commercial truck and bus drivers
- Medications and driving
- Driving with cardiovascular disease, diabetes, neurological disorders, renal disease, seizure disorders, sleep disorders and other acute medical conditions
- Hearing impairment and driving?
- Musculoskeletal disease and injury among truck and bus drivers
- Injury and return-to-work issues among truck and bus drivers
- Psychiatric illness and driving
- Monocular vision impairment and commercial truck/bus operation
